CVS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review

1,972 of the 5,651 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in CVS Health (CVS)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$68.1B — up 17% from $58.2B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 277 funds opened new CVS positions and 94 closed out — a net gain of 183 holders — while 842 added to existing stakes and 720 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Capital International Investors, adding an estimated $272M. The largest seller was BlackRock, cutting an estimated $508M.
